Bullying • Engaging in written or verbal expression, expression through electronic means, or physical conduct that occurs on school property, at a school-sponsored or school-related activity or in a vehicle operated by the district and creates an imbalance of power. • Is severe, pervasive and persistent • See Texas Education Code 37,0832

  3. Types of Bullying • Written • Verbal • Electronic (Cyber) • Physical

  4. Indicators of Bullying • Obvious Indicators • A child tells you about it • A friend of the child tells you about it • You find a note/letter with names • A child writes about it in class/at home • Posted on facebook/twitter/text messages/etc

Indicators of Bullying • Covert Indicators • A change in mood with your child • A rise in anxiety around lunch, weekends, before school or after school • Child not wanting to spend time with friends • Child acting out with attention seeking behavior • Making excuses for spending more time at home

Ways to deal with Bullying • Victim • Have the child explain the situation(s) in detail • Normalize their feelings by acknowledging what the child is telling you • Find out what the child would like the outcome to be • What has the child tried already to stop it? • If it happened at school, let the school know.

Ways to deal with Bullying • Bully • Have the child explain the situation(s) in detail • Normalize their feelings by acknowledging what the child is telling you • Why are they picking on the other child? Has the other child done something to them? • If it happened at school, let the school know. • What is happening with the child for them to act this way towards others?
